Notes of crisp orchard fruit, flowers and toasted almonds introduce the 2024 Ladoix Le Clou d’Orge (Domaine Gagey), a medium-bodied, satiny and fine-boned white that’s bright and mineral. It’s being matured in foudre. This is always one of the insiders’ choices in the range.


The 2022 Ladoix Clos d’Orge has a clean, quite crisp nose of mainly yellow fruit with a touch of orange blossom. The palate is well-balanced with a fine thread of acidity. It is not a complex Ladoix, but I admire the tension and a sense of refinement on the finish. Well-crafted
